Win95's editor has the terrible feature that when you save the file as 'text file (*.txt)' as, say, 'myquery.sql', it creates a file named 'myquery.sql.txt'. Great, ey? Be sure that, when saving your SQL statement, you select 'All files (*.*)'. That should create a file with the name you specify and with no appendix '.txt'.
